Under what circumstances can you not wear a mask?

2020-06-10

Wearing masks scientifically has a preventive effect on respiratory infections such as new coronary pneumonia and flu, which not only protects oneself, but also benefits public health. At present, under the situation of fighting against the new coronary pneumonia epidemic, in order to guide the public to wear masks scientifically to effectively prevent and control the epidemic and protect public health, the following guidelines are specially proposed.

 

1. The general public

(1) At home and outdoors, there is no gathering of people and good ventilation. Protection advice: don't wear a mask.

(2) In places where people are dense, such as offices, shopping, restaurants, meeting rooms, workshops, etc.; or take a van elevator, public transportation, etc. Protection recommendations:

In medium and low-risk areas, spare masks (disposable medical masks or medical surgical masks) should be worn with you, and wear masks when in close contact with other people (less than or equal to 1 meter).

In high-risk areas, wear disposable medical masks.

(3) For those who have cold symptoms such as coughing or sneezing. Protection recommendations: wear disposable medical masks or medical surgical masks.

(4) For those who live in isolation from their homes and who are discharged from the hospital. Protection recommendations: wear disposable medical masks or medical surgical masks.


2. Personnel in specific places

(1) It is located in a crowded hospital, bus station, train station, subway station, airport, supermarket, restaurant, public transportation, and the import and export of communities and units.

Protection recommendations:

In medium and low risk areas, staff wear disposable medical masks or surgical masks.

In high-risk areas, workers wear medical surgical masks or protective masks that meet KN95/N95 and above.

(2) In crowded places such as prisons, nursing homes, welfare homes, mental health medical institutions, school classrooms, and construction site dormitories. Protection recommendations:

In medium and low-risk areas, spare masks (disposable medical masks or medical surgical masks) should be worn with you daily, and wear masks when people gather or make close contact with others (less than or equal to 1 meter).

In high-risk areas, workers wear medical surgical masks or protective masks that meet KN95/N95 and above; other personnel wear disposable medical masks.
